Transaction 5ee5e283fee5efca6df005c7e3597d67ca4795f718d5c5f23a797383bfa2ca68

53 Input
1 Outputs
  • 5ee5e283fee5efca6df005c7e3597d67ca4795f718d5c5f23a797383bfa2ca68:0
  • value  377612
    address  12huE2XNvHrPrzdw2CKMFtU3H13K6xiRYN